Mobile explosion-proof UPS uninterruptible power supply for mining

Mobile explosion-proof UPS uninterruptible power supply for mining

Mine flameproof uninterruptible power supply box (hereinafter referred to as "power box") is suitable for underground coal mines in explosive environments, and is specially designed to provide DC power supply completely independent of the power supply system for power supply equipment such as high-voltage explosion-proof switches and low-voltage feed switches in the underground Electrical substation; The power box integrates advanced lithium battery matching technology, charge and discharge management technology, balance technology, explosion-proof technology, communication bus technology, display technology, etc., providing stable and reliable backup power supply for electrical equipment. Cooling methods for industrial and commercial lithium battery energy storage

Cooling methods for industrial and commercial lithium battery energy storage

As industrial and commercial energy storage systems gain more demand, battery performance in terms of efficiency, safety, and lifespan is crucial. Thermal management is vital as batteries heat up during operation. In this regard, three main cooling technologies - air cooling, liquid cooling, and immersion cooling - are prominent in the field of industrial and commercial energy storage batteries.
